Bread pakora. Bread pakora is an Indian and Pakistani fried snack (pakora or fritter). It is also known as bread bhaji (or bajji). A common street food, it is made from bread slices, gram flour, and spices among other ingredients.

The ingredients needed to make Bread pakora:

  1. Prepare 10 of bread slices.
  2. Get 1 cup of cabbage (small cutting).
  3. Prepare 1 cup of boiled chicken.
  4. Get 3 of medium potatoes boiled.
  5. Make ready 2-3 of Green chillis.
  6. Prepare of Few leaves Fresh coriander.
  7. Get 1 tbs of red chilli powder.
  8. Make ready Half of tbs red chilli flacks.
  9. Take to taste of Salt add.
  10. Make ready 1 tsp of Cumin seed.
  11. Take 1 tsp of Crushed coriander.
  12. Get of Ketchup.
  13. Prepare of Besan preparation.
  14. Take 1 cup of besan.
  15. Take of Water as required.
  16. Make ready 1 tbs of red chilli powder.
  17. Prepare to taste of Salt.
  18. Get 1 tsp of cumin seeds.
  19. Make ready 1 tsp of turmeric.
  20. Prepare 1 tsp of ginger garlic paste.

Instructions to make Bread pakora:

  1. Prepare the besan.... Add water and all ingredients in besan and make a semi thick mixture.
  2. Boil the chicken add black pepper powder and salt in it.
  3. Sherd the chicken in small pieces.
  4. Mash the potatoes.
  5. Take a bowl Add cabbage chicken all spices in the mashed potatoes and mix them well.
  6. Now remove the edges of bread slices.
  7. Apply ketchup on slice and spread the mixture on it.
  8. Take a simple slice and apply ketchup on it and place this slice on the other slice which has mixture.... Like sandwich 🥪.
  9. Cut it in triangle shape and dip the sandwich in besan mixture.
  10. Heat the oil and fry these sandwiches untill golden brown.
  11. Serve with ketchup or mayo.
  12. Ready to eat.

Bread pakora is simply two bread slices dipped in gram flour (besan) batter and then fried. Some people prefer to bake bread pakora; however, the authentic taste lies in deep frying the pakora.
